✨Tip Number 1

Familiarise yourself with the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ework. Understanding its principles and learning goals will help you demonstrate your knowledge during interviews and show that you're committed to supporting children's development.

✨Tip Number 2

Gain some hands-on experience by volunteering or shadowing in a nursery or early years setting. This practical exposure will not only enhance your CV but also give you real-life examples to discuss during your interview.

✨Tip Number 3

Network with professionals in the education sector. Attend local workshops or events related to early years education, as this can lead to valuable connections and insights about job openings, including our positions at StudySmarter.

✨Tip Number 4

Prepare for common interview questions specific to early years education. Think about scenarios where you've supported children's learning or dealt with challenging behaviour, as these examples will showcase your suitability for the role.

Some tips for your application 🫡

Understand the Role: Read the job description carefully to understand the responsibilities and requirements of an Early Years Teaching Assistant. Tailor your application to highlight relevant experience and skills that align with the role.

Craft a Personal Statement: Write a personal statement that reflects your passion for early years education. Share specific examples of your experience working with young children and how you can contribute to their development.

Highlight Relevant Qualifications: Make sure to include any relevant qualifications or training in early childhood education. If you have certifications or courses related to child development, mention them prominently in your CV.

Proofread Your Application: Before submitting your application, proofread it for any spelling or grammatical errors. A well-presented application shows attention to detail and professionalism, which is crucial in an educational setting.

How to prepare for a job interview at Connex Education Partnership Birmingham Limited

✨Show Your Passion for Early Years Education

Make sure to express your enthusiasm for working with young children. Share any relevant experiences or stories that highlight your commitment to early years education, as this will resonate well with the interviewers.

✨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ions

Expect questions that ask how you would handle specific situations in a nursery setting. Think about examples from your past experiences where you successfully supported children's learning and development.

✨Familiarise Yourself with Child Development Principles

Brush up on key concepts related to child development and early learning frameworks. Being able to discuss these principles confidently will demonstrate your knowledge and suitability for the role.

✨Ask Insightful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ions to ask at the end of the interview. Inquire about the nursery's approach to early years education or how they support their staff, showing that you are genuinely interested in the position and the environment.
